By Glenn Drexhage on June 5, 2012
UBC is honouring Dr. Irving K. Barber with a Celebration of Life event on June 11 – and you’re invited to take part. Dr. Barber, who recently passed away, contributed millions of dollars to promote education and research throughout British Columbia. On May 30, a special ceremony was held during UBC’s spring congregation to recognize and honour the Japanese Canadian students whose university experience was disrupted in 1942 when they were uprooted and exiled from the B.C. coast – a violation of their citizenship rights.
